I I ,. <br /> <br /> Director Ponty introduced the supporting counsel and consultants in the audience: <br /> Redevelopment Agency Executive Director Church, Virginia Horler fTom Rausher Pierce <br />- Refsnes, Inc., Russ Miller and Sean Tierney fTom Stradling, Yocca, Carlson & Rauth, <br /> bond counsel, and Stephanie Lovette fTom Katz Hollis & Coren, financial adviser. <br /> In response to Chairman Hartnett's questions, Redevelopment Agency Attorney <br /> Schricker said he had no further information to add to his previous letter to the Council. <br /> He advised he had spoken with the underwriters' attorneys "and they are amenable to <br /> making the changes." <br /> Chairman Hartnett asked Attorney Schricker, "Based upon those changes being <br /> incorporated in the statement that would be issued to the public, it is your opinion that it <br /> adequately discloses that which needs to be disclosed?" Attorney Schricker replied <br /> "That is correct, insofar as the legal aspects are concerned. I refer to staff with respect to <br /> factual matters, but.... my view of it is, that it adequately discloses the information <br /> required, with the modifications as indicated in my letter." <br /> Mayor Hartnett asked if anyone in the audience wished to speak to this issue. No one <br /> came forward. <br /> MIS: CLAIREIBUCHAN. TITLE READ. <br /> RESOLUTION NO. RD97-01 OF THE REDEVELOPMENT AGENCY OF THE CITY OF <br />- REDWOOD CITY PROVIDING FOR THE ISSUANCE AND SALE OF REDEVELOPMENT <br /> PROJECT AREA NO.2, TAX ALLOCATION REFUNDING BONDS, SERIES 1996 <br /> ADOPTED BY UNANIMOUS ROLL CALL VOTE. <br /> ---------------------------------------------------------------____-_n___--__-------------------------------------- <br /> B. Adoption of Rules and Regulations for implementing Relocation Assistance Law and <br /> Property Acquisition Procedures (403) <br /> This Agenda Item was removed by Chairman Hartnett to allow the Redevelopment Agency <br /> Board Members to review all the Relocation Guidelines documents, and will be <br /> rescheduled/or a later Redevelopment Agency regular meeting. <br /> MINUTE ORDER NO. 97-02RD <br /> 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------ <br /> 4 CLOSED SESSION <br /> None held. <br />- <br /> SPECIAL REDEVELOPMENT AGENCY MEETING JANUARY 6,1997 <br /> MINUTES MINUTE BOOK NO.1 PAGE 3 <br /> Page No. 383 <br />
